Outreach Surveillance Project (COVID-19)
The Office of Clinical Informatics (OCI), in collaboration with the Department of Internal Medicine and the Office of Clinical Affairs, recently completed an outreach campaign aimed at informing the most vulnerable Texas Tech Physicians of El Paso patient population of their available options for virtual visits and telemedicine due to theCOVID-19 pandemic.
High Risk Patient Population Eligibility: Over 60 years of age; lives in the following3 zip codes 79936, 79938, and 79928; is affected by one or more of the following diseases/conditions: immunocompromised, diabetes, lung disease, heart disease.
